Major Duties Under general supervision, the Laborer performs physical tasks such as moving objects, assisting in cleaning projects, supporting construction activities, maintaining landscaping, operating equipment, responding to emergencies, and ensuring safe handling of supplies.
- Moves and lifts heavy objects such as furniture, equipment and supplies; assists in event set-up.
- Cleans assigned areas including activities such as removing construction debris; cleaning gutters, culverts, and other drainage structures.
- Assists trades and construction workers by performing unskilled tasks such as preparing work areas.
- Assists in maintaining landscape including pruning, trimming, and removing debris.
- Responds to emergencies and operates emergency equipment.
- Performs other duties as assigned.

Licenses: Valid California driver’s license.
Knowledge, Skills, & Abilities - Ability to read and write English at a level appropriate to the duties of the position; and follow verbal and written instructions to.
- Demonstrated capability to safely lift, move, and handle heavy furniture, equipment, and supplies (up to 50 pounds), and perform physically demanding tasks related to campus event setups.
- Knowledge of basic cleaning techniques including debris removal, gutter and drainage maintenance, mechanical equipment cleaning, and recycling practices.
- Ability to perform general labor support tasks such as preparing construction sites, executing basic repair duties, patching pavement, and handling pick and shovel work effectively.
- Skilled in basic landscape maintenance tasks including pruning, trimming, spraying shrubs and trees, removing undergrowth, and preparing grounds using manual tools such as spades, hoes, and rakes.
